]> git.donarmstrong.com Git - neurodebian.git/blob - sphinx/index.rst
Merge branch 'master' of git://git.debian.org/pkg-exppsy/neurodebian
[neurodebian.git] / sphinx / index.rst
1 .. _WELCOme:
2
3 ***************************************************
4  Welcome to the Ultimate Platform for Neuroscience
5 ***************************************************
6
7 .. quotes::
8    :random: 1
9
10 The NeuroDebian project provides a turnkey platform for neuroscience
11 through integrating of related software within the Debian_ operating
12 system.  If you are using neuroscience-related software which
13 comes with you installation of Debian_ or its derivative, such as
14 Ubuntu_, good chance is that you are already *using NeuroDebian*.
15
16 This website provides an additional repository with both unofficial
17 or prospective packages which are not (yet) available from the main
18 Debian_ archive, as well as backported or simply rebuilt newest
19 versions of packages.  Please see the :ref:`faq` for more information
20 about the goals of this project, and :ref:`read what people say about
21 it <testimonials>`.  Take a look at the :ref:`list of our current and
22 planned projects <projects>` if you want to get involved. If you
23 appreciate this service, please |spread|.
24 This service is provided "as is". There is no guarantee that a package
25 works as expected, so use them at your own risk. If you encounter problems,
26 please `report <#contacts>`_ them.
27
28 .. raw:: html
29
30  <p>
31  <a href="pkgs.html"><img border="0" src="_static/package.png" title="Software package list" /></a>
32  <a href="pkglists/pkgs-by_release-datasets_(data).html"><img border="0" src="_static/datasets.png" title="Dataset package list" /></a>
33  <a href="vm.html"><img border="0" src="_static/machine.png" title="Get NeuroDebian for your non-Debian computer" /></a>
34  <a href="debian/pool"><img border="0" src="_static/pool.png" title="Go to the package pool (deep and cold, only for experts)" /></a>
35  <a href="projects.html"><img border="0" src="_static/workarea.png" title="Current and planned projects: Get involved!" /></a>
36  <a href="blog/index.html"><img border="0" src="_static/rssfeeds.png" title="NeuroDebian Insider Blog" /></a>
37  </p>
38
39 .. _Ubuntu: http://www.ubuntu.com
40
41 .. _news:
42
43 News
44 ====
45
46 .. raw:: html
47
48  <script src="_static/jquery.livetwitter.min.js"></script>
49  <div id="identica_widget"></div>
50  <script type="text/javascript">
51  $("#identica_widget").liveTwitter('neurodebian',
52                                    {service: 'identi.ca',
53                                     mode: 'user_timeline',
54                                     limit: 10,
55                                     rate: 300000});
56  </script>
57
58 For more news and information see our :ref:`blog <blog>`. Older news items are
59 available on identi.ca_. Follow us on identi.ca_ (preferred) or twitter_ to
60 subscribe to the NeuroDebian news.
61
62 .. _identi.ca: http://identi.ca/neurodebian
63 .. _twitter: http://twitter.com/NeuroDebian
64
65 .. _repository_howto:
66
67
68
69 How to use this repository
70 ==========================
71
72 To enable the NeuroDebian repository on your system, select your Debian or
73 Ubuntu release and a repository mirror from the lists below. Upon selection
74 a short command snippet will be displayed that can be copied and pasted into
75 a terminal session. These commands will configure the system package manager
76 with the NeuroDebian repository key and package source information.
77
78 .. include:: sources_lists
79
80 Once this is done, you have to update the package index and you are ready to
81 install packages. Use your favorite package manager, e.g. synaptic, adept. In
82 the terminal you can use :command:`apt-get`::
83
84   sudo apt-get update
85   sudo apt-get install mricron
86
87 .. note::
88
89   Not every package is available for all distributions/releases. For information
90   about which package version is available for which release and architecture,
91   please have a look at the corresponding package pages.
92
93 .. raw:: html
94
95  <p><img border="0" src="_files/nd_subscriptionstats.png" title="Statistics of new repository subscriptions for all supported releases. Note: subscription is only done once per machine." /></p>
96
97 Popularity Contest
98 ------------------
99
100 We would strongly encourage you to participate in the `popularity
101 contest <http://popcon.debian.org>`_ (popcon), which anonymously
102 collects the list of packages you installed/use on your system.
103 Collecting such statistics is of particular importance for research
104 software projects as a prove of an existing user-base.  If upon
105 installation of the system you rejected the invitation to participate
106 you can always change your decision by running::
107
108  sudo dpkg-reconfigure popularity-contest
109
110 .. note::
111
112    If you are deploying multiple systems through cloning, to not have
113    all systems considered as one, it would be necessary to re-generate
114    the random MY_HOSTID.  Following commands ran as root should do it
115    (as root) without any interactive dialog::
116
117     sed -i -e 's,PARTICIPATE *= *.no.,PARTICIPATE="yes",g' -e '/^ *MY_HOSTID/d' /etc/popularity-contest.conf
118     DEBIAN_FRONTEND=noninteractive dpkg-reconfigure popularity-contest
119
120 In addition to popcon pages for your "core" distribution (e.g. `Debian
121 <http://popcon.debian.org/>`__ or `Ubuntu
122 <http://popcon.ubuntu.com/>`__) you can see/get statistics for
123 submissions to `NeuroDebian <http://neuro.debian.net/popcon/>`__ and
124 know that you are already contributing back to the community.
125
126 .. _chap_installation:
127
128 Ways to use NeuroDebian
129 =======================
130
131 Virtual machine
132 ---------------
133
134 If you are not running Debian_ on a particular machine a :ref:`chap_vm` is
135 provided as a convenient testing and evaluation environment.  After a few
136 simple steps to setup the virtual machine, you will be able to use NeuroDebian_
137 as an integral part of your existing working environment without any sacrifice.
138 The virtual machine is also a suitable environment to temporarily deploy
139 neuroscience software on machines running other operating systems, e.g. for the
140 purpose of teaching a neuroimaging data analysis course in a multipurpose
141 computer lab.
142
143
144 Debian installation
145 -------------------
146
147 Having been exposed to the wonders of NeuroDebian_ you are no longer
148 satisfied with your previous choice of operating system?  We would
149 recommend installing Debian_ to replace or complement (dual-boot) your
150 existing OS.  Please visit `"Getting Debian"
151 <http://www.debian.org/distrib/>`_ to obtain the images for your
152 hardware architecture and then simply add |repos|.
153
154
155 .. _chap_team:
156
157
158 The team
159 ========
160
161 Our main goal is to provide neuroscience FOSS_ for Debian_. Thus the
162 whole project would not be possible without the work of over 3,000
163 Debian_ developers and contributors who are as enthusiastically pursuing
164 a similar goal.  To add our share -- Debian_ packages of FOSS_ for
165 neuroscience research -- the `Experimental Psychology Debian packaging
166 project <http://alioth.debian.org/projects/pkg-exppsy>`_ was created
167 to formally join the forces of
168
169 * `Michael Hanke <http://mih.voxindeserto.de>`_
170 * `Yaroslav Halchenko <http://www.onerussian.com>`_
171
172 A number of packages that are now available from the NeuroDebian repository
173 were not packaged by our team, but similar Debian teams.  Therefore we want to
174 express particular gratitude to the `Debian Med`_ and `Debian Science`_ teams
175 for all their work.
176
177 .. _support:
178
179 Contacts
180 ========
181
182 `Email us directly <team@neuro.debian.net>`_ with any "private"
183 communication.  Otherwise please use our public mailing lists, which
184 exist not only to provide user-support but also to establish
185 communication channels within the NeuroDebian community
186
187 * neurodebian-users_: Discussions and support of NeuroDebian users
188
189 * neurodebian-upstream_: General discussions and knowledge sharing
190   among developers of the neuroscience software.  We will also use it
191   to update you with summaries of recent relevant developments in
192   Debian project
193
194 * neurodebian-devel_: Technical mailing list for discussions on
195   NeuroDebian development
196
197 You are welcome also to join #neurodebian IRC room on OFTC network if
198 you have quick questions or want to join a live discussion.
199
200 Acknowledgements
201 ================
202
203 We are grateful to `Jim Haxby`_ for his continued support and :ref:`endless supply of
204 Italian espresso <coffeeart>`.
205
206 .. _Jim Haxby: http://haxbylab.dartmouth.edu/ppl/jim.html
207
208 Thanks to the following institutions and individuals for hosting a mirror:
209
210 * `Department of Psychological and Brain Sciences at Dartmouth College`_
211   *[us-nh]* (primary mirror)
212 * `Department of Experimental Psychology at the University of Magdeburg`_
213   *[de]*
214 * `Neurobot at Aristotle University of Thessaloniki, Greece`_ *[gr]*
215 * `Paul Ivanov`_ *[us-ca]*
216 * `Medical-image Analysis and Statistical Interpretation lab at Vanderbilt`_
217   *[us-tn]*
218 * `Australia's research and education network (AARNET)
219   <http://www.aarnet.edu.au>`_ *[au]*
220
221 If your are interested in mirroring the repository, please see the :ref:`faq`.
222
223 .. _Department of Psychological and Brain Sciences at Dartmouth College: http://www.dartmouth.edu/~psych
224 .. _Department of Experimental Psychology at the University of Magdeburg: http://apsy.gse.uni-magdeburg.de
225 .. _Neurobot at Aristotle University of Thessaloniki, Greece: http://neurobot.bio.auth.gr
226 .. _Paul Ivanov: http://www.pirsquared.org
227 .. _Medical-image Analysis and Statistical Interpretation lab at Vanderbilt: https://masi.vuse.vanderbilt.edu
228
229
230 Publications
231 ============
232
233 Hanke, M. (2012). `Rock solid, brand new, everyday, for free, not a joke:
234 NeuroDebian <_files/Hanke_NeuroDebian_MPI2012.pdf>`_.
235 *Talk given at the Max-Planck-Institute for Human Cognitive and Brain
236 Sciences*, Leipzig, Germany.
237
238 Hanke, M. (2011). `More than batteries included: NeuroDebian
239 <_files/Hanke_NeuroDebian_EuroSciPy2011.pdf>`_.
240 *Talk given at the Python in Neuroscience satellite of EuroScipy 2011*,
241 Paris, France.
242
243 Halchenko, Y. O. (2011). `π's in Debian or Scientific Debian: NumPy, SciPy and beyond
244 <_files/Halchenko_EuroScipy11_3_14s_in_Debian.pdf>`_.
245 *Talk given at* `EuroScipy 2011 <http://www.euroscipy.org/talk/4379>`_,
246 Paris, France.
247
248 Hanke, M. & Halchenko, Y. O. (2011). `Neuroscience runs on GNU/Linux
249 <http://www.frontiersin.org/Neuroinformatics/10.3389/fninf.2011.00008/full>`_.
250 *Frontiers in Neuroinformatics, 5:8*.
251
252 Hanke, M., Halchenko, Y. O. & Haxby, J. V. (2011). `NeuroDebian -- versatile
253 platform for brain-imaging research <_files/NeuroDebian_HBM2011.png>`_
254 *Poster presented at the annual meeting of the Organisation for Human Brain
255 Mapping*, Quebec City, Canada.
256
257 Hanke, M. (2011). `Integrating Condor into the Debian operating system
258 <_files/Hanke_CondorDebianIntegration_CondorWeek2011.pdf>`_.
259 *Talk given at* `CondorWeek 2011
260 <http://www.cs.wisc.edu/condor/CondorWeek2011/wednesday_condor.html>`_,
261 Madison, Wisconsin, USA.
262
263 Hanke, M. & Halchenko, Y. O. (2010). :ref:`Report from the Debian booth at
264 SfN2010 <chap_debian_booth_sfn2010>`. *Annual meeting of the Society for
265 Neuroscience*, San Diego, USA.
266
267 Halchenko, Y. O., Hanke, M., Haxby, J. V., Pollmann, S. & Raizada, R. D.
268 (2010). `Having trouble getting your Nature paper? Maybe you are not using the
269 right tools? <_files/NeuroDebian_SfN2010.png>`_ *Poster presented at the
270 annual meeting of the Society for Neuroscience*, San Diego, USA.
271
272 Hanke, M., Halchenko, Y. O. (2010). `Debian: The ultimate platform for
273 neuroimaging research <_files/HankeHalchenko_NeuroDebianDebConf10.pdf>`_.
274 *Talk given at* DebConf10_, New York City, USA. [video:
275 `low resolution <http://meetings-archive.debian.net/pub/debian-meetings/2010/debconf10/low/1310_1310_Debian_The_ultimate_platform_for_neuroimaging_research.ogv>`_,
276 `high resolution <http://meetings-archive.debian.net/pub/debian-meetings/2010/debconf10/high/1310_1310_Debian_The_ultimate_platform_for_neuroimaging_research.ogv>`_]
277
278 Hanke, M., Halchenko, Y. O., Haxby, J. V. & Pollmann, S. (2010). `Improving
279 efficiency in cognitive neuroscience research with NeuroDebian
280 <_files/NeuroDebian_CNS2010.pdf>`_. *Poster presented at the annual
281 meeting of the Cognitive Neuroscience Society*, Montréal, Canada.
282
283 Halchenko, Y. O., Hanke, M. (2009). `An ecosystem of neuroimaging,
284 statistical learning, and open-source software to make research more
285 efficient, more open, and more fun
286 <_files/HalchenkoHanke_FossEcosystemDC09.pdf>`_. *Talk given at*
287 `Dartmouth College`_, New Hampshire, USA.
288
289 .. _DebConf10: http://debconf10.debconf.org/
290 .. _Dartmouth College: http://www.dartmouth.edu/
291
292
293 .. toctree::
294    :hidden:
295
296    blog/index
297    faq
298    pkgs
299    spread
300    vm
301    coffeeart
302    photoalbum
303    projects
304    testimonials
305
306 .. probably should be purged altogether
307 .. toctree::
308    :hidden:
309
310    booth_sfn2010
311    datasets
312    livecd
313    quotes-nihr01
314    quotes-nitrc
315    sources_lists
316    vm_welcome
317
318 .. include:: link_names.txt
319 .. include:: substitutions.txt